Inadequate Flashing Installation



Picking the right products isn't the only aspect that can lead to roofing issues; poor flashing setup can likewise develop substantial issues. Flashing is vital for guiding water away from prone areas, such as chimneys, skylights, and roof covering valleys. If it's not installed correctly, you take the chance of water invasion, which can bring about mold and mildew development and architectural damage.

Neglecting Ventilation Demands



While several home owners concentrate on the visual and structural aspects of roofing system installment, disregarding air flow requirements can bring about major long-lasting consequences. Appropriate air flow is vital for regulating temperature level and moisture levels in your attic, protecting against concerns like mold and mildew development, timber rot, and ice dams. If you don't mount sufficient air flow, you're setting your roof up for failure.

To prevent this blunder, first, examine your home's particular air flow needs. A well balanced system generally includes both intake and exhaust vents to promote air flow. Ensure you have actually installed so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the peak of your roof covering. This combination allows hot air to run away while cooler air goes into, keeping your attic space comfortable.
